Output e6b371d305909db8e307838a5542c132652aeae08ef41dc81781d5122a002bfa:6

value
676538
script pubkey
OP_0 OP_PUSHBYTES_20 40fab09afc49f6e40cb9f3ce746a105c638987e0
address
bc1qgratpxhuf8mwgr9e7088g6sst33cnplqew9rr6
transaction
e6b371d305909db8e307838a5542c132652aeae08ef41dc81781d5122a002bfa